vue字段变红色是什么意思
-
当Vue字段变红色时,通常表示该字段在Vue实例中绑定的数据发生了变化。
在Vue中,数据绑定是一个重要的概念,用于将数据和视图进行关联。Vue使用双向数据绑定的方式,通过将数据对象与HTML模板进行绑定,当数据发生变化时,视图会自动更新,反之亦然。
当一个字段的变量在Vue实例中绑定,并且该变量的值发生了改变时,Vue会触发重新渲染视图的过程。为了提高性能,Vue使用了虚拟DOM的概念,只更新发生变化的部分。
Vue会通过比较新旧值来确定哪些部分需要重新渲染,用到的是浅比较的方式。当一个字段发生改变时,Vue会遍历所有的依赖关系,找到相关的组件或模板,然后重新渲染这些组件或模板。而在调试过程中,Vue会用红色标记那些需要重新渲染的部分,以便开发人员进行观察和调试。
因此,当Vue字段变红色时,就意味着该字段在数据绑定中发生了变化,需要进行重新渲染。这个特性可以帮助开发人员更方便地追踪数据和视图之间的关系,及时发现潜在的问题和错误。
总之,Vue字段变红色表示该字段在Vue实例中绑定的数据发生了变化,需要重新渲染视图。这是Vue框架为开发人员提供的一个非常有用的调试特性,可以帮助我们更好地理解和调试Vue应用程序。
1年前 -
在Vue中,字段变红色通常表示该字段的值发生变化或者出现了错误。这可以是由于使用了Vue的双向绑定功能,当数据发生变化时,Vue会自动更新相关的DOM元素,并通过改变其样式来反映数据的变化。当字段的值发生变化时,Vue会将与该字段相关的DOM元素的样式改为红色,以便用户知道数据发生了变化。
字段变红色还可以是由于验证错误。在表单验证过程中,当某个字段的值不符合指定的规则或条件时,通常会将该字段的样式设为红色,以提示用户输入错误或需要更正的地方。这是通过在字段的DOM元素上添加一个指定红色样式的class来实现的。
另外,字段变红色还可能是由于在Vue的模板中使用了条件渲染或计算属性。通过在模板中使用v-if或v-show指令,我们可以根据特定的条件来显示或隐藏某个字段或DOM元素。当条件不满足时,字段可能被隐藏,导致字段颜色变为红色以表示其隐藏状态。同样地,当计算属性的结果为false或undefined时,字段也可能会被隐藏并变红色。
最后,字段变红色还可能是由于开发人员自定义了某个特定的业务逻辑。根据实际需求,开发人员可以在Vue组件中添加代码,以实现字段变红色的逻辑。例如,当字段的值超出了某个范围或满足了特定的条件时,开发人员可以将字段的样式更改为红色,以提醒用户。这通常是通过在字段的DOM元素上修改样式或添加class来实现的。
总结起来,Vue中字段变红色通常表示字段的值发生变化、验证错误、条件渲染或计算属性的结果为false,或开发人员自定义的业务逻辑。不同的情况下,字段变红色可能有不同的含义和处理方式。
1年前 -
在Vue中,字段变红色通常表示该字段出现了错误或异常。Vue提供了一种双向数据绑定的机制,可以将数据和视图进行关联,当数据发生变化时,视图会自动更新。当字段变红色时,通常代表该字段的值或绑定出现了问题。
字段变红色可能有以下几种情况:
-
语法错误:当你在Vue的模板中使用了错误的语法时,字段所在的位置会被标记为红色。这通常是由于拼写错误、错误的表达式或不完整的语句引起的。你可以通过检查错误提示信息或Vue的开发工具来定位并修复语法错误。
-
数据绑定错误:当字段的数据绑定出现问题时,字段会变红色。这可能是由于不存在的属性、未定义的变量或无效的表达式导致的。你可以检查数据绑定的语法和对象属性是否正确,确保所绑定的数据存在并且具有正确的类型。
-
校验错误:在表单中使用Vue进行数据校验时,如果字段的值不满足校验规则,字段会标记为红色。你可以在表单元素上添加校验规则,比如使用Vue的内置指令v-model或v-bind来指定校验规则,然后使用条件判断或自定义校验函数来进行验证。
-
异步加载错误:当字段的值是异步加载的结果时,如果加载出现错误,字段会变红色。这通常发生在使用异步请求获取远程数据时出现网络错误或服务器错误。你可以通过捕获异步请求的错误并进行适当的处理,比如显示错误提示信息或重试加载数据。
总之,字段变红色意味着在Vue中出现了问题,你需要仔细检查错误提示信息以及相关的代码和数据绑定,以找出并修复问题。
1年前 -